Subject: reboot: fix overflow parsing reboot cpu number
Limit the CPU number to num_possible_cpus(), because setting it to a value
lower than INT_MAX but higher than NR_CPUS produces the following error on
reboot and shutdown:

kernel/reboot.c | 7 +++++++
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+)
--- a/kernel/reboot.c~reboot-fix-overflow-parsing-reboot-cpu-number
+++ a/kernel/reboot.c
@@ -558,6 +558,13 @@ static int __init reboot_setup(char *str
reboot_cpu = simple_strtoul(str+3, NULL, 0);
else
*mode = REBOOT_SOFT;
+ if (reboot_cpu >= num_possible_cpus()) {
+ pr_err("Ignoring the CPU number in reboot= option. "
+ "CPU %d exceeds possible cpu number %d\n",
+ reboot_cpu, num_possible_cpus());
+ reboot_cpu = 0;
+ break;
+ }
break;
